Key Features

KushoAI

  • Automated test suite generation from Postman collections.
  • Support for OpenAPI specs to create comprehensive tests.
  • Integration with CI/CD pipelines for seamless testing.
  • AI-driven analysis to optimize test coverage and efficiency.
  • Real-time reporting and insights on test results.

Terraform Cloud

  • Version control for infrastructure changes to track and manage updates.
  • AI-powered policy suggestions to ensure compliance and best practices.
  • Support for multiple cloud providers for flexible infrastructure management.
  • Collaboration tools for teams to work on infrastructure as code together.
  • Automated infrastructure provisioning to streamline deployment processes.
